Why Drive Tasmania’s East Coast?
Stretching from Orford in the south to St Helens in the north, Tasmania’s East Coast is a winding ribbon of turquoise waters, white sand beaches, and charming coastal towns. It’s about a 300 km journey, easily done in a few days, but with plenty of options for longer stays.
Unlike mainland cities like Sydney, Tassie’s roads are quieter, the air is crisp, and the views are unbeatable. A self-drive trip gives you total freedom—stop at secret lookouts, linger in sleepy towns, or take spontaneous detours whenever the mood strikes.
Best Stops Along the East Coast Drive
Here are some must-visit destinations to include on your self-drive itinerary from Hobart to St Helens.
Orford & Triabunna
Just over an hour from Hobart, Orford is the perfect first stop. Enjoy a beachside picnic or catch the ferry from Triabunna to Maria Island, known for its wildlife and historic ruins.
Swansea & Great Oyster Bay
Continue north to Swansea, a quiet seaside town with incredible views across Great Oyster Bay to the Hazards mountain range. It’s a great place to refuel (both your car and yourself) and try fresh local seafood.
Freycinet National Park

Bicheno
This friendly town is a favourite for families and wildlife lovers. Visit the Bicheno Blowhole, snorkel in the marine reserve, or go on a penguin tour at dusk.
St Helens & the Bay of Fires
Finish your journey in St Helens, gateway to the spectacular Bay of Fires. With its orange-lichen-covered rocks and untouched beaches, it’s the perfect spot to unwind, swim, or snap a few postcards-worthy photos before heading back.
Travel Tips for a Smooth Journey
Drive on the left (as you do in all of Australia).
Fuel up regularly: Towns can be spaced out and fuel stations may close early—especially on weekends.
Watch for wildlife: Especially around dusk and dawn. Wallabies and wombats are common near the roadside.
Take it slow: Many parts of the East Coast are about the journey, not the destination. Allow time for stops, side trips, and soaking in the views.
